glasses-water-fruit-fruits-water-drink-colorful-lid-straws-garden-thumbnail.jpgTypes of Childcare Options

There are many kinds of child care solutions, each catering to various age groups and schedules. A few of the most typical types of childcare choices include:

  1. Daycare Centers: Daycare centers tend to be services that offer take care of young ones of varied many years, usually from infancy to preschool. These facilities tend to be accredited and controlled by the state, ensuring that they meet particular criteria for safety, sanitation, and staff skills. Daycare centers offer structured activities, dishes, and direction for the kids in friends setting.

  1. Family Child Care Homes: Family child care houses are tiny, home-based child care facilities run by a single caregiver or a small selection of caregivers. These providers provide a more personalized and family-like environment for the kids, with less kids in care compared to daycare centers. Family child care homes can offer versatile hours and rates, making them a favorite choice for moms and dads who require more individualized take care of their child.

  1. Preschools: Preschools are educational institutions that offer early youth education for kids typically involving the centuries of 2 to five years old. These programs concentrate on organizing kids for kindergarten by presenting them to basic educational ideas, personal skills, and emotional development. Preschools frequently work on a school-year schedule and offer part-time or full time alternatives for parents.

  1. Pre and post School tools: pre and post college programs are designed to provide take care of school-aged kiddies through the hours before and after the normal college time. These programs provide multiple tasks, homework help, and direction for the kids while moms and dads are in work. Before and after college programs are typically offered by schools, neighborhood facilities, or private businesses.

  1. Nanny or Au Pair: Nannies and au sets tend to be people who offer in-home child care solutions for households. Nannies in many cases are skilled experts who offer full-time care for kiddies into the family's house, while au sets tend to be young adults from international countries which live using the family members and supply social change along side childcare. Nannies and au pairs provide personalized treatment and flexibility in scheduling for parents.

Factors to Consider Whenever Choosing Childcare

When selecting childcare near you, it is essential to start thinking about a number of aspects to make sure that you find an excellent and ideal selection for your youngster. Some of the important aspects to think about feature:

  1. Licensing and Accreditation: it is crucial to choose a licensed and approved child care supplier, because helps to ensure that the center fulfills certain requirements for safety, cleanliness, staff qualifications, and program high quality. Licensing and accreditation indicate the supplier features encountered a rigorous assessment process and is dedicated to keeping high standards of treatment.

  1. Team Qualifications and Training: The qualifications and training regarding the staff at childcare facility are crucial in providing high quality look after children. Try to find providers who've trained and experienced caregivers, including staff that are certified in CPR and first aid. Staff-to-child ratios will also be important, because they determine the degree of interest and direction that every son or daughter receives.

  1. Curriculum and Program strategies: think about the curriculum and system tasks provided by the kid care provider, as they perform an important role into the development and understanding of your kid. Seek programs that provide age-appropriate tasks, educational options, and possibilities for socialization. A well-rounded curriculum which includes play, art, songs, and outside time can play a role in your son or daughter's overall development.

  1. Safety and health Policies: make sure that the child care supplier features rigid safe practices policies positioned to protect the well being of your child. Choose services that follow appropriate hygiene practices, have safe entry and exit treatments, and keep maintaining on a clean and child-friendly environment. Ask about emergency treatments, disease policies, and just how the provider handles accidents or situations.

  1. Parent Involvement and Communication: Pick a kid care provider that motivates moms and dad involvement and keeps open communication with families. Choose providers offering possibilities for parents to take part in tasks, activities, and conferences, in addition to regular changes on your young child's progress and well being. A powerful partnership between parents and caregivers may cause a confident and supporting child care knowledge.

Finding Childcare Near You

Now you have considered the aspects to look for in a kid treatment provider, it is time to start the find high quality childcare near you. Below are a few tips and sources to help you find a very good option for your youngster:

  1. Require guidelines: Start by seeking guidelines from family members, friends, next-door neighbors, and colleagues that have kiddies in child care. Personal referrals is an invaluable supply of details about quality child care providers locally. Ask about their experiences, what they like about the provider, and any problems they may have.

  1. Analysis Online: Use online resources such childcare directories, parenting sites, and social networking groups to analyze childcare providers in your area. Look for providers with positive reviews, high rankings, and detailed information about their programs and solutions. Numerous providers have actually sites or social networking pages where you could learn more about their particular services and staff.

  1. Visit Child Care facilities: Schedule visits to prospective child care facilities to visit the services, meet the staff, and take notice of the program doing his thing. Pay attention to the hygiene, security precautions, and total atmosphere of this center. Make inquiries concerning the curriculum, staff skills, everyday routines, and guidelines for a sense of the way the center runs.

  1. Interview Caregivers: When meeting with potential caregivers, inquire about their particular knowledge, training, and approach to childcare. Inquire about their particular philosophy on discipline, interaction with moms and dads, and exactly how they handle emergencies or challenging actions. Trust your instincts and select caregivers who're cozy, mindful, and responsive to your son or daughter's needs.

  1. Examine sources: Request recommendations from childcare provider and contact them to check out their particular experiences aided by the supplier. Enquire about the standard of attention, interaction with parents, staff interactions, and any issues they could experienced. References can provide valuable insights into the provider's reputation and background.

  1. Start thinking about price and Convenience: Take into account the price of childcare and how it fits to your spending plan, plus the ease of the place and hours of operation. Compare rates, costs, and repayment choices among various providers to Find top-rated certified Daycares in your area the best value for your needs. Give consideration to elements such as transport, distance to your home or work, and mobility in scheduling.
